Top View Of Seljalandsfoss Falls In Iceland With Powerful Water Cascade From Steep Cliff. aerial orb

Top View Of Seljalandsfoss Falls In Iceland With Powerful Water Cascade From Steep Cliff. aerial orbit

Most Popular Searches On Stock Footage